Hi,
why is the following set analysis not working:?
sum({<Tree Name]=,Tree Group]={'$(=only([Tree Group]))'}, [ID]=,[Number Of Trees= >} ({$(=vExpTotal )}* 1000))
this variable vExpTotal is using another variable. Do I have to do something to the first variable?

		May be because you are missing some square brackets or is that a typo?
Sum({<[Tree Name]=,[Tree Group]={'$(=only([Tree Group]))'}, [ID]=,[Number Of Trees]= >} ({$(=vExpTotal )}* 1000))
